引用次数: 0

摘要

目的:横纹肌肉瘤(Rhabdomyosarcoma, RMS)是一种罕见的软组织肉瘤,主要影响儿童和青少年。泌尿生殖系统是RMS的第二个常见部位。我们报告了女性生殖道RMS的治疗效果和长期生存结果。方法:选取1996年1月~ 2023年12月北京协和医院诊断为女性生殖器RMS的患者,年龄小于25岁。记录临床特征、治疗方式和生存结果。根据儿童肿瘤组(COG)风险分层系统重新评估患者预后。结果:共纳入26例患者,平均年龄8.1岁。中位随访时间为59.3个月。原发肿瘤部位分布如下:阴道(n=12)、宫颈(n=8)、外阴(n=2)、盆腔(n=2)、子宫(n=1)、会阴皮下(n=1)。COG风险分层系统将15例患者分为低风险亚群1,8例为低风险亚群2,2例为中风险亚群,1例为高风险亚群。9例患者(34.62%)出现疾病复发,中位无进展生存期为15.3个月。疾病特异性死亡率为26.92%(7/26)。6例(复发病例的66.7%)复发后死亡,1例4期患者在初始治疗期间死亡。结论:早期诊断为女性生殖道RMS的患者预后较好。晚期和非标准初始治疗与复发风险增加相关。疾病复发的患者往往预后差,死亡率高。

Long-term survival outcomes of female genital tract rhabdomyosarcoma in children, adolescents and young adults at a national rare disease diagnosis and treatment center in China.

Objective: Rhabdomyosarcoma (RMS) is a rare soft-tissue sarcoma mainly affecting children and adolescents. The genitourinary tract is the second common site involved by RMS. We report the therapeutic effects and long-term survival outcomes of female genital tract RMS.

Methods: Patients diagnosed with female genital RMS and younger than 25 years old from Peking Union Medical College Hospital between January 1996 and December 2023 were identified. Clinical features, treatment modalities, and survival outcomes were documented. Patient prognosis evaluation was re-evaluated according to the Children's Oncology Group (COG) risk stratification system.

Results: A total of 26 patients were included, with a mean age of 8.1 years. The median follow-up duration was 59.3 months. Primary tumor sites were distributed as follows: vagina (n=12), cervix (n=8), vulva (n=2), pelvic region (n=2), uterus (n=1), and subcutaneous perineum (n=1). The COG Risk Stratification System classified 15 patients as low-risk subset 1, 8 as low-risk subset 2, 2 as intermediate-risk, and 1 as high-risk. Nine patients (34.62%) experienced disease recurrence with a median progression free survival of 15.3 months. The disease-specific mortality rate was 26.92% (7/26). Six patients (66.7% of recurrent cases) succumbed to the disease following recurrence, while one stage 4 patient died during initial treatment.

Conclusion: Patients diagnosed as RMS in female genital tract in early stage can have relatively good prognosis. Advanced stage and nonstandard primary treatment were related with increased risk of recurrence. Patients with disease recurrence tend to have poor prognoses and higher mortality rates.
